Software Dispatch was a disk-based app store that was distributed with CD-ROM-equiped Macintosh Performa models in the mid 1990s.
The CD-ROM contained 70 "great applications" that could be unlocked with a code that could be purchased through a toll-free telephone call or a faxed order form.
